If the Will left you something it is hard to imagine your sister, the Executor, will not honor it. It is over a year since the Will was probated and nothing was done. I suggest having an attorney write her demanding both an accounting of the estate and an explanation why the bequest under the Will has not been paid to date. Has your sister given you any reason why she refuses to pay the bequest?
